Home Demolition Service in South Houston, TX
Home demolition services involve the careful and efficient removal of existing structures on residential properties, including houses, garages, sheds, and other outbuildings. These projects typically include complete teardown of the entire building or selective demolition of specific sections, preparing the property for renovations, new construction, or land clearing. Property owners interested in these services should consider factors such as the size and type of the structure, the presence of hazardous materials like asbestos or lead paint, and local regulations that may influence the demolition process.
Before requesting home demolition,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including what will be removed and how debris will be handled. It’s also important to consider permits, potential impacts on neighboring properties, and the timeline for completion. Clear communication about these details helps ensure the project aligns with property goals and complies with any local requirements.

Common Home Demolition Service Jobs
Whole House Demolition - complete removal of an entire residence for rebuilding or renovation projects.
Garage Demolition - tearing down garages to create space for new construction or landscaping.
Interior Demolition - removing interior walls, fixtures, or flooring to prepare for remodeling.
Commercial Demolition - safely demolishing commercial structures to accommodate new business developments.
Selective Demolition - partial removal of specific building sections to preserve other areas.
Foundation Demolition - tearing out old foundations to make way for new construction or upgrades.
Home Demolition Service Questions
What types of structures can be demolished? Home demolition services typically handle houses, garages, sheds, and other residential buildings.
Is a permit required for demolition? Property owners should check local regulations, as permits are often necessary for demolition projects in South Houston.
What should be prepared before demolition begins? Clear the area of personal belongings and obstacles to ensure a smooth and safe demolition process.
Are there any restrictions on demolishing certain structures? Some structures may have restrictions due to zoning or safety codes; consulting local guidelines is recommended.
